Results and Evaluations Improved Accuracy 2008: 13.24% defects 2010: 1.46% defects Reduced Percentage Error 2008: -12.99% 2010: 2.7%
18
Results and Evaluations Enhanced Speed of Operation For 100 Cycle Run: 2008: 7 min 49.7sec 2010: 2 min 27sec 3.19 Times Faster
19
Results and Evaluations Capstan Feed Design Removed Drift Factor Smaller Size of the Machine 4.7 Times Smaller in Area LEGO Servo Motors Eliminated Overheating Issue Sources of Error Susceptible to Ribbon Feed Method Ribbon at Similar Elevation Improves Accuracy Significantly
